WebSep 7, 2024 · It is not necessary to disinfect the skin with alcohol, iodine, or other cleansers. Cool the burn. After cleaning, use a cool compress or cloth on the skin or immerse the area in cool tap water. Keep the cool compress or water on the skin for about 10 minutes or until the pain decreases. Do not use ice on burned skin. WebIt is important for parents and guardians to recognize their own emotional reactions to their child’s burn injury and to take care of themselves and seek help if the reactions don’t go away with time. Things you can do: Take time for yourself. Get back into the activities that relax and energize you.
